In the Libya Prostate Specific Antigen (PSA) Test Market, challenges primarily revolve around limited access to healthcare services in remote regions, lack of awareness about the importance of early detection of prostate cancer, and a shortage of trained healthcare professionals to administer and interpret the PSA tests accurately. Additionally, the political instability and security concerns in Libya pose significant barriers to the smooth functioning of healthcare facilities, including diagnostic laboratories offering PSA testing services. Moreover, the high cost of PSA tests and limited health insurance coverage further restrict the affordability and availability of these tests to a broader population. These challenges collectively hinder the timely diagnosis and management of prostate cancer cases in Libya, highlighting the need for targeted interventions to improve access, awareness, affordability, and quality of PSA testing services in the country.

Government policies related to the Libya Prostate Specific Antigen Test Market are primarily focused on healthcare regulations and quality standards. The Ministry of Health in Libya oversees the registration and approval of medical devices, including PSA tests, ensuring they meet safety and efficacy requirements. Importing and selling medical devices, including PSA tests, are subject to strict licensing and quality control measures to protect public health. Additionally, government policies may include guidelines for healthcare providers on the appropriate use and interpretation of PSA test results to promote accurate diagnosis and treatment of prostate cancer. Continuous monitoring and updates to regulations may be implemented to ensure the quality and reliability of PSA tests in the Libyan market.
